Greece - Import of Live Swine Except Pure-Bred Breeding Weighing 50 kg or More

Since 2014, Greece Import of Live Swine Except Pure-Bred Breeding Weighing 50 kg or More decreased by 19.9% year on year. At $22,143.22 in 2019, the country was ranked number 51 among other countries in Import of Live Swine Except Pure-Bred Breeding Weighing 50 kg or More. Greece is overtaken by Zambia, which was ranked number 50 at $23,436 and is followed by Canada with $20,203.27. Germany ranked the highest with $584,079,000.67 in 2019, that is +6.7% compared to 2018. Portugal, United States and Netherlands resp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Mexico witnessed the best average annual growth at +123.7% per year, while Russia was the worst growing country at -78% per year.
